Now’s your moment ⌚️ — 42 weeks pregnant

It's go time. We agree—you've been pregnant long enough. You've survived morning sickness, leg cramps, food cravings, due dates and impatient family members. YOU. ARE. READY. By this time, baby is fully developed and the lifespan of the placenta, which provides nutrients to baby, is running out. If you've waited this long, it's now time to give that little one some extra help entering the world—with the assistance of your medical provider. Ready to go ⏰ — 41 weeks pregnant

How pregnant am I? Too pregnant. We know—you can't stand the wait. ⌚️ (We can't either!) But the countdown is now officially on, so use your bonus days pre-baby to slow down, sleep and envision your little one in your arms. Any day, baby will make his debut into the world. While you are not technically overdue until 42 weeks, we know it already feels like baby is late (you're grounded!) and your medical provider will likely start talking to you about induction planning. Your body is ready for labor, and we're just sitting here waiting for the mysterious, miraculous process to officially begin. Baby will be here very soon!XO, TeamMotherlyP.S. Rest up, mama —22 weeks pregnant

Being a sleepy girl with a busy life is hard. Sleep when the baby sleeps, they say. Well, are you lying down? Because now your sleepy little baby now has distinct periods of activity and rest, and may even react to loud sounds like your dog barking or fave workout music playing. (AWWW! ?) You may also be noticing your own body changing—stretch marks, weight gain and slightly swollen hands and feet. So take the break that you deserve from all this human-growing work, and schedule a Babymoon for the next 10 weeks. Rest and recharge, lady. Your baby will be here before you know it.
